Bahama Mama Bronzer by theBalm: A Golden Brown Without Orange Undertones

October 2nd, 2014 by Karen 14 Comments

theBalm Bahama Mama Bronzer (1)

theBalm Bahama Mama Bronzer (2)

Victory is ours! Power to the scrunchie!

theBalm Bahama Mama Bronzer (7)

I’ve been on the hunt for a matte golden brown bronzer without any orange undertones because I like to switch up my bronzer game every once in a while, and I finally found one — Bahama Mama Bronzer by theBalm ($20, available now at theBalm counters and online. ).

The golden brown color reminds me of a big pan of MAC Soba Eyeshadow, but with a matte finish instead of a sheen. Good for contouring cheeks, or as an eyeshadow, or for adding overall warmth to the face.

Unsung Makeup Heroes: theBalm Cindy-Lou Manizer

August 19th, 2014 by Karen 10 Comments

Quick! Grab my hand! Guuuuurl, we’re making a prison break. I’m busting you out of this shimmer-free solitary confinement, Shawshank-style, with theBalm’s Cindy-Lou Manizer ($24).

Super shiny highlights without the drama of a finicky frost

theBalm Cindy-Lou Manizer
It’s theBalm…

With peachy pink Cindy-Lou, theBalm got it totally right. You can wear this powder as a highlighter, an eyeshadow or a blush. The fabulous finish is unconditionally Unsung Heroes worthy.

The otherworldly opalescent sheen lifts dull skin, making your mug look fresh, bright and alive. The effect is like a Broadway spotlight manned by the best lighting guy in the biz — dramatic, but still soft and flattering, and without the harshness of a high-shine frost.

A little goes a loooong way…

theBalm Cindy-Lou Manizer
Watch out for Cindy-Lou!

It’s important to use just a smidgen, though. A little definitely goes a long way with this.

I like to load a skinny tapered eyeshadow brush like the MAC 224 by running it lightly across the pan. Then I’ll gently buff that on my upper cheekbones, down the bridge of my nose and on my Cupid’s bow, where it lasts from 8-9 hours (without touchups) on my combination dry/oily skin.

I’ve been wearing it a ton lately for “KA-POW!” highlights on my upper cheekbones, and the best thing about it? — it doesn’t settle into my fine lines or embiggen my pores.

theBalm Read My Lips Lip Gloss in Pow Packs a Wallop

July 23rd, 2014 by Karen 5 Comments

theBalm Read My Lips Lip Gloss in Pow

theBalm Read My Lips Lip Gloss in Pow

You’d expect a lipgloss named “Pow!” to pack a punch, and this opaque fuchsia gloss by theBalm does just that (it even contains ginseng!).

I like wearing this with black cat eye liner and lots o’ lashes on days when I can’t be bothered by eyeshadow (*flips hair*).

A word to the wise: wear lip liner with this one, as it’s pigmented and opaque, which is great, but it also has a lot of slip because it’s not very sticky, so it tends to scoot around outside the natural lip line, especially if you rub your lips throughout the day like yours truly.

Yeah, I wore this the other day, and my bottom lip ended up looking all sorts of Baby Jane cray…

A lip liner will keep it from wandering beyond where you want it to go, POW! 🙂

You can find Pow making a statement at theBalm counters and online. It’s $15 for a 0.219-ounce tube.

PRICE: $15
AVAILABILITY: Available now at theBalm counters and online
MAKEUP AND BEAUTY BLOG RATING: A- (slightly high maintenance, needs lip liner)

Read My Lips: This Nude Lip Gloss by theBalm Deserves Big Snaps

July 22nd, 2014 by Karen 5 Comments

theBalm Read My Lips Lipgloss in Snap (1)

theBalm Read My Lips Lipgloss in Snap (2)

Oh, snap, honey! As far as nude lipglosses go, theBalm’s Read My Lips Lip Gloss in Snap has it — *three snaps in a Z formation* — on point.

I find that many lipglosses, particularly nude lipglosses, aren’t pigmented enough to completely cover my naturally pigmented lips, and so my natural lip color peeks through.

And then with opaque nude lipglosses, so many of them look chalky or patchy or just plain weird.

Snap by theBalm ($15) suffers from none of that nonsense/crazy-business. It’s incredibly smooth and completely full coverage. A subtle injection of rich, rosy brownish pink gives it just enough color to lift up my lips…so I don’t look like some unfortunate extra on CSI who got picked off early in the first few minutes of the show.

PRICE: $15
AVAILABILITY: Available now at theBalm counters and online
MAKEUP AND BEAUTY BLOG RATING: A+

So I Was Wearing This Pink Lip Gloss From theBalm When All of a Sudden, Bam!

July 21st, 2014 by Karen 11 Comments

Full-coverage yellowish pink Bam is one of the new Read My Lips Lip Glosses from theBalm, a gang of 11 glosses with a comic book theme. They’re enriched with green tea, antioxidants and moisturizing aloe, with coverage ranging from medium to full, depending on the color. Cost, $15 a pop.

The basics on Bam

  • Finish: Creamy, with no glitter at all.
  • Texture: Comfy. Bam’s non-sticky formula goes on smoothly and feels great.
  • Moisture level: More moisturizing than Aquaman and Prince Namor combined, aka hella moisturizing.
  • Wear time: About 2-3 hours on my lips.
  • Flavor and scent: Yup, both. Bam has a faint berry flavor and scent that quickly fades.

Bam has been a steady member of my purse gloss superhero team for about a month because it goes with everything. Smokey eyes, neutral eyes — you name it. And because it’s highly pigmented, I can get a nude lip look with just a couple swipes.

Plus, the warm yellow undertones keep my lips from looking too flat or blah…which can happen sometimes with light pink glosses.

I can only think of one thing that would have taken it to the next level… Wear time. Four hours would’ve been nice (instead of 2-3), but that’s just me being picky.

Other than having room for a little longer wear time, Bam is a winner with me.

PRICE: $15
AVAILABILITY: Available now at theBalm counters and online at thebalm.com
MAKEUP AND BEAUTY BLOG RATING: A
